Cold weather conditions expected over next three days
Cold weather conditions expected over next three days

Tuesday, the weather conditions are expected to be relatively cold in most parts of the Kingdom, and moderate weather conditions are expected in the Jordan Valley, the Dead Sea and Aqaba, with southeasterly moderate to active winds, according to the Jordan Meteorological Department (JMD).

Temperatures will range between 18 degrees Celsius and six degrees in Amman. It will be warmer in Aqaba, reaching 24 degrees Celsius during the day and 12 degrees at night.

In the evening, the weather is expected to be colder nationwide, the JMD said, noting that clouds will gradually build up in the late night hours, making a chance of light and scattered rain in the northern regions.

Wednesday, the Kingdom will be affected by a cold air mass, with temperatures dropping down and bringing cold and partly cloudy conditions with spotty showers in the northern and central highlands, the JMD added.

Thursday, the country will remain under the impact of the cold air mass. However, the weather will stabilize at night, with a possibility of fog formation over highlands and the Badia areas, the JMD said.
